Hi everyone I'm new to this and since no one believe me when I bring up new symptoms I'd like some input from people who are going through similar experiences. I've have what drs call silent/occular migraines for 2 months. Everyone I see say it's caused by servere anxiety/ stress. I'm a hypochondriac so anything will throw red flags. I've always had flashes of light in vision (noticed them after my very first migraine with aura 7 years ago) now they've gotten progressively worse. I Saw an optomologist and checked out fine they do see me more often because I have one optic nerve bigger then the other. So they suspect glaucoma but each time they test me they clear me for the time being. A few days ago i started to notice that when I cover my left eye my right eye which is the one with the bigger optic nerve goes dark like a curtain covers half my vision. It's only when i stare at something. And any small movement or visual adjustment it goes away but quickly comes back until I uncover my left eye. It doesn't happen with the other eye. So Im worried I'm going to go blind maybe they missed diagnosed glaucoma or it could be ms. In the last 3 months I've seen a cardiologist, ophthalmologist, 2 PCP and I er dr. All diagnosed me with silent migraine. Because of shakey vision like lines and patterns move and of the flashes of lights in both eyes. Any ideas as to what be going on?
